I have a two-node MC cluster running HP-UX 10.20. About a month ago, I tried
to
run 'cmviewcl -v' and found out that the command stopped working. It just sat
there as if it was waiting for something. There was no errors in the system
logs.
Two weeks ago, I had to reboot this cluster and found out that the cluster
would
not form afterwards. Same problem, when I ran 'cmruncl -v', it just sat. I
finally had to bring them up as stand-alone units. Although everything works,
it loses the failover capacity.
Today, I tried to create ignite tapes for these two systems, the commands
'make_recovery -Av' also sat for hours as if it was waiting for something.
Again, there was no error messages in the syslogs.
Anyone can shed some light on this for me?
